Solution Overview
Problem
Current central management systems for network devices, such as access points and switches, can ensure that configuration files are up-to-date but fail to validate if the settings are correctly implemented, leading to potential unauthorized access as devices may incorrectly implement configurations, turning secure networks into insecure ones.
Innovation Solution
A method and system that involve a controller transmitting requests to network devices for their configuration status, determining if the implemented status matches the intended configuration, and performing a recovery process to adjust the settings when a mismatch is found, ensuring proper execution and preventing unauthorized access.

Systems, methods, and computer-readable media are disclosed for remotely managing and correcting implementation of configuration settings at network devices operating in the network. In one aspect of the present disclosure, a method includes transmitting, by a controller, a request to a network device of the network for a status of operation of the network device with respect at least one configuration setting available at the network device; determining, by the controller, whether the status matches an operation status provided by the at least one configuration setting; and performing, by the controller, a recovery process to adjust the implementation of the at least one configuration setting when the determining determines that the status does not match the operation status.
